About Black Culinary History
A place for black chef to show up, and put down our history in food!!! Company Overview Black Culinary History is a place for minority chefs, hospitality professionals, and those interested in the evolution of black people in the culinary arts to come together for fellowship, information sharing,and mentorship. Mission The mission of the group has evolved since the beginning to be come more about preservation of the black legacy in food. Through chef profiles, event coverage, multimedia information sharing, and an aggressive mentorship program Black Culinary History is focused on keeping the black chef immersed in the work and providing constant muse moments to maintain the excitement and enthusiasm that made us all choose this career path
